Applied Companies is Hiring a Program Manager Near Santa Clarita, CA

JOB SUMMARY

As a Program Manager (PM) at Applied Companies, you will be responsible for managing multiple programs for both Government and commercial customers in a fast-paced design and manufacturing environment. This position is responsible for analyzing customer requirements, cost, schedule, technical/performance, risk, and execution of active programs. The PM will establish, and is accountable to maintain, a collaborative working relationship with customer program managers to ensure that the highest level of responsiveness and customer service needs are met. Internally, the Program Manager will coordinate with other departments (sales, engineering, supply chain, manufacturing, operations, quality, etc.) to execute on program requirements in an efficient and effective manner.

As a small company, Applied Companies relies on the capabilities and good judgement of its people. We unleash the talent of our employees rather than controlling it with hierarchy or excessive bureaucracy. Subsequently, the person in this role will be a trusted decision maker, empowered to act in the best interest of Applied and its customers. We provide a pleasant, professional, and dynamic entrepreneurial work environment where creativity is encouraged.

Every person at Applied is expected to help when and where needed. In addition to program management-related responsibilities, the person in this role will be asked to contribute technically in his/her area of expertise, and to help propose/win new business for our growing company. 

SPECIFIC JOB ACCOUNTABILITIES

· Manage multiple programs to ensure compliance to customer requirements while maintaining strict adherence to cost and schedule performance goals. Role requires hands-on program financial control experience.

  • Analyze customer requirements including proposal, specifications. statements of work, and terms & conditions to identify opportunities and risks throughout the life of assigned programs (proposal to post-delivery support).
  • Closely coordinate with Directors of Engineering and Operations to ensure all assigned programs are executed to plan.
  • Represent company as primary point of customer contact for all assigned programs.
  • Manage, prepare and execute internal and external design reviews.
  • Coordinate, generate, prepare and submit data deliverables (CDRLs/SDRLs) to customer.
  • Collect, track, analyze and report on cost, schedule, and technical metrics to assess program health.
  • Coordinate and monitor invoicing of assigned programs.
  • Support proposal review and development and manage follow-on business opportunities for all assigned programs, products and customers.
  • Participate as a major contributor to the improvement of program management and program financial control improvement process.

KEY RELATIONSHIPS

The Program Manager reports directly to the Vice President of Business Development. The Program Manager must also closely communicate/coordinate with the Engineering, Supply Chain, Manufacturing, Operations, and Quality departments.

REQUIREMENTS

· B.S. Mechanical, Electrical, Aeronautical, or Refrigeration Systems Engineering degree or equivalent technical degree.

· A minimum of 5 years of recent program management with experience in Aerospace manufacturing and a technical aptitude.

· Engineering background with knowledge in military/tactical applications.

· Proven ability to manage multiple programs of short duration (4 to 12 months) within established cost and schedule goals.

· Ability to foster and maintain positive relationships within the Company’s own departments and throughout our valued Customer organizations.

· Effectively prioritize multiple tasks and manage time efficiently.

· High degree of business management acumen.

· Effective verbal (phone and face-to-face) and written communication skills.

· Fluent with Microsoft Project and resources planning/allocation techniques.

· Expert user with Microsoft Office tools including Excel, PowerPoint, Word, and Outlook.

· Self-starter with demonstrated desire to go the extra mile.

DESIRABLE

  • Experience in a small but fast-growing company

TRAVEL

  • Moderate travel is required

ABOUT APPLIED COMPANIES

  • Applied Companies, Inc. is a Southern California manufacturer of ruggedized Environmental Control Units (ECU’s) and Pressure Vessels for tactical military systems. We have been in business since 1958 and offer a competitive salary and benefits package that includes medical, dental, and vision, along with a generous 401K match and profit-sharing program. Veteran-Founded | Woman-Owned
